Female Shark Learns To Reproduce Without Males After Years Alone

An anonymous reader quotes a report from New Scientist: A female shark separated from her long-term mate has developed the ability to have babies on her own. Leonie the zebra shark (Stegostoma fasciatum) met her male partner at an aquarium in Townsville, Australia, in 1999. They had more than two dozen offspring together before he was moved to another tank in 2012. From then on, Leonie did not have any male contact. But in early 2016, she had three baby sharks. Intrigued, Christine Dudgeon at the University of Queensland in Brisbane, Australia, and her colleagues began fishing for answers. One possibility was that Leonie had been storing sperm from her ex and using it to fertilize her eggs. But genetic testing showed that the babies only carried DNA from their mum, indicating they had been conceived via asexual reproduction. Some vertebrate species have the ability to reproduce asexually even though they normally reproduce sexually. These include certain sharks, turkeys, Komodo dragons, snakes and rays. However, most reports have been in females who have never had male partners. In sharks, asexual reproduction can occur when a female’s egg is fertilized by an adjacent cell known as a polar body, Dudgeon says. This also contains the female’s genetic material, leading to “extreme inbreeding”, she says. “It’s not a strategy for surviving many generations because it reduces genetic diversity and adaptability.” Nevertheless, it may be necessary at times when males are scarce. “It might be a holding-on mechanism, ” Dudgeon says. “Mum’s genes get passed down from female to female until there are males available to mate with.” It’s possible that the switch from sexual to asexual reproduction is not that unusual; we just haven’t known to look for it, Dudgeon says. Malwarebytes Discovers ‘First Mac Malware of 2017’

wiredmikey writes: Security researchers have a uncovered a Mac OS based espionage malware they have named “Quimitchin.” The malware is what they consider to be “the first Mac malware of 2017, ” which appears to be a classic espionage tool. While it has some old code and appears to have existed undetected for some time, it works. It was discovered when an IT admin noticed unusual traffic coming from a particular Mac, and has been seen infecting Macs at biomedical facilities. From SecurityWeek.com: “Quimitchin comprises just two files: a .plist file that simply keeps the .client running at all times, and the .client file containing the payload. The latter is a ‘minified and obfuscated’ perl script that is more novel in design. It combines three components, Thomas Reed, director of Mac offerings at Malwarebytes and author of the blog post told SecurityWeek: ‘a Mac binary, another perl script and a Java class tacked on at the end in the __DATA__ section of the main perl script. The script extracts these, writes them to /tmp/ and executes them.’ Its primary purpose seems to be screen captures and webcam access, making it a classic espionage tool. Somewhat surprisingly the code uses antique system calls. ‘These are some truly ancient functions, as far as the tech world is concerned, dating back to pre-OS X days, ‘ he wrote in the blog post. ‘In addition, the binary also includes the open source libjpeg code, which was last updated in 1998.’ The script also contains Linux shell commands. Running the malware on a Linux machine, Malwarebytes ‘found that — with the exception of the Mach-O binary — everything ran just fine.’ It is possible that there is a specific Linux variant of the malware in existence — but the researchers have not been able to find one. It did find two Windows executable files, courtesy of VirusTotal, that communicated with the same CC server. One of them even used the same libjpeg library, which hasn’t been updated since 1998, as that used by Quimitchin.” Read more of this story at Slashdot.

Hackers Corrupt Data For Cloud-Based Medical Marijuana System

Long-time Slashdot reader t0qer writes: I’m the IT director at a medical marijuana dispensary. Last week the point of sales system we were using was hacked… What scares me about this breach is, I have about 30, 000 patients in my database alone. If this company has 1, 000 more customers like me, even half of that is still 15 million people on a list of people that “Smoke pot”… ” No patient, consumer, or client data was ever extracted or viewed, ” the company’s data directory has said. “The forensic analysis proves that. The data was encrypted — so it couldn’t have been viewed — and it was never extracted, so nobody has it and could attempt decryption.” They’re saying it was a “targeted” attack meant to corrupt the data rather than retrieve it, and they’re “reconstructing historical data” from backups, though their web site adds that their backup sites were also targeted. “In response to this attack, all client sites have been migrated to a new, more secure environment, ” the company’s CEO announced on YouTube Saturday, adding that “Keeping our client’s data secure has always been our top priority.” Last week one industry publication had reported that the outage “has sent 1, 000 marijuana retailers in 23 states scrambling to handle everything from sales and inventory management to regulatory compliance issues.” Read more of this story at Slashdot.

Hamas ‘Honey Trap’ Dupes Israeli Soldiers

wiredmikey quotes Security Week: The smartphones of dozens of Israeli soldiers were hacked by Hamas militants pretending to be attractive young women online, an Israeli military official said Wednesday. Using fake profiles on Facebook with alluring photos, Hamas members contacted the soldiers via groups on the social network, luring them into long chats, the official told journalists on condition of anonymity. Dozens of the predominantly lower-ranked soldiers were convinced enough by the honey trap to download fake applications which enabled Hamas to take control of their phones, according to the official. MIT Unveils New Material That’s Strongest and Lightest On Earth

A team of MIT researchers have created the world’s strongest and lightest material known to man using graphene. Futurism reports: Graphene, which was heretofore, the strongest material known to man, is made from an extremely thin sheet of carbon atoms arranged in two dimensions. But there’s one drawback: while notable for its thinness and unique electrical properties, it’s very difficult to create useful, three-dimensional materials out of graphene. Now, a team of MIT researchers discovered that taking small flakes of graphene and fusing them following a mesh-like structure not only retains the material’s strength, but the graphene also remains porous. Based on experiments conducted on 3D printed models, researchers have determined that this new material, with its distinct geometry, is actually stronger than graphene — making it 10 times stronger than steel, with only five percent of its density. The discovery of a material that is extremely strong but exceptionally lightweight will have numerous applications. As MIT reports: “The new findings show that the crucial aspect of the new 3-D forms has more to do with their unusual geometrical configuration than with the material itself, which suggests that similar strong, lightweight materials could be made from a variety of materials by creating similar geometric features.” Read more of this story at Slashdot.

Fewer People Are Dying of Cancer Than Ever Before

The number of Americans dying of cancer has dropped to a 25-year low, equaling an estimated 2, 143, 200 fewer deaths in that period, says the new annual report from the American Cancer Society. In that time, the racial and gender disparities that exist in cancer rates have also narrowed somewhat, but they remain wide in many places. From a report on The Outline: Though the incidence of cancer remained stable for women and dropped slightly — by 2 percent — in men, rates remain overall 20 percent higher in men while rate of death for men is 40 percent higher than in women. The rates of both incidence and death vary wildly based on the type of cancer. The data that the ACS is using run through the end of 2014 for incidents of cancer and through 2013 for deaths. Lung cancer remains the leading cause of cancer death in the United States for both men and women.. Read more of this story at Slashdot.

A Squishy Clockwork BioBot Releases Doses of Drugs Inside the Body

the_newsbeagle writes: Making micro-machines that work inside the body is tricky, because hard silicon and metal devices can cause problems. So bioengineers are working on soft and squishy gadgets that can be implanted and do useful work. Here’s a soft biobot that’s modeled on a Swiss watch mechanism called a Geneva drive. With every tick forward, the tiny gizmo releases a dose of drugs. Getting the material properties just right was a challenge. “If your material is collapsing like jello, it’s hard to make robots out of it, ” says inventor Samuel Sia.
